Summary

The Akima Financial Systems Administrator is involved in the day-to-day support of the Deltek Enterprise in place at Akima, LLC. The Deltek Enterprise currently consists of three On-Prem Deltek Costpoint 8.2 Oracle databases using a combination of multi-org and multi-company configurations, Time & Expense with ESS (T&E) 10 and Cognos. There is also a subsidiary system, Microsoft Dynamics 365 CRM and Business Central, that will also be supported. The primary focus of this role will focus on supporting Costpoint, T&E and Cognos.

This position is a tremendous growth opportunity for the right person to learn about the leading software used in the government contracting industry.

Responsibilities

  • Costpoint User access management
  • Monitor the Akima Helpdesk tickets received and perform level 1-2 troubleshooting
  • Tracking and recording hot fixes and enhancement updates received from Deltek.
  • Lead teams in Costpoint hot fix/patch testing.
  • Monitor all Deltek Enterprise scheduled activities troubleshoot any issues encountered.
  • Escalate tier 2 and 3 issues to team members for advanced troubleshooting with Senior Enterprise Managers and Deltek.
  • Submit and monitor Deltek Enterprise issues submitted to the Deltek support site for resolution.
  • Monitor the status of the Deltek Enterprise license counts, tasks, departmental user flow.
  • Create and submit monthly metrics/statistics to the Enterprise Director regarding Deltek Enterprise performance.
  • Take the lead on IT projects assigned that involve the Enterprise Apps department.
  • Familiarity with Costpoint multi-company and multi-org configurations setup and functionality.
  • Advanced troubleshooting skills in resolving GL to PSR to Revenue Worksheet reconciliation issues.
  • Intermediate to Advanced knowledge of Costpoint's core module functionality in Costpoint 8.2 and T&E 10 or greater.
  • Intermediate to advanced knowledge of Costpoint Payroll module functionality including SCA and DBA type employees.
  • Familiarity with Costpoint Materials Product definition, Procurement Planning, Purchasing, Receiving and Inventory modules.
  • Familiarity with Costpoint Pool setups and cyclical burdening processes.
  • Create basic reports and adhoc queries in Cognos Analytics.
  • Other Deltek Enterprise related duties as assigned.
  • Support the administration of Microsoft Dynamics 365 CRM (On-Prem).
  • Support the administration of Dynamics 365 Business Centra l(On-Prem).
  • Familiarity with Microsoft Power BI and reporting on Business Central and CRM.

Company Description

Work Where it Matters

Akima is not just another global enterprise and federal contractor. As an Alaska Native Corporation (ANC), our mission and purpose extend beyond our exciting federal projects as we support our shareholder communities in Alaska.

At Akima, the work you do every day makes a difference in the lives of our 15,000 Iupiat shareholders, a group of Alaska natives from one of the most remote and harshest environments in the United States.

For our shareholders, Akima provides support and employment opportunities and contributes to the survival of a culture that has thrived above the Arctic Circle for more than 10,000 years.

For our government customers, Akima delivers agile solutions in the core areas of facilities, maintenance, and repair; information technology; logistics; protective services; systems engineering; mission support; furniture, fixtures & equipment (FF&E); and construction.
